KENT, Ohio - Kent police arrested the man accused of "prowling" around outside of KSU sorority houses only wearing a pair of underwear.
Police said they and the U.S. Marshal's office were able to learn who the alleged culprit was Friday night.
That's when officers arrested Steven Franzreb, 43, of North Royalton, in Broadview Heights near Cleveland without incident.
He was charged with menacing by stalking.
Franzreb went viral through the Kent State community for allegedly showing up outside sorority houses nearly in the nude, with writing across his body.
According to NBC affiliate WKYC in Cleveland, Franzreb pleaded not guilty in court Monday and is being held on a $50,000 bond.
